Day 4 – Dublin, Ireland

This was our last full day in Ireland, and we had already turned in our rental car at this point. The main plan for this day was to have afternoon tea and also find a restaurant/pub to eat at with live music. We also managed to stop by a church in the morning and listen to their amazing choir.

I first started off the day by having breakfast and doing some reading at a cafe just a handful of steps away from the church:

The church we decided to visit was Christ Church Dublin and it happened to be Trinity Sunday:

At 3:00 pm, we had afternoon tea at a cute place called the Old Music Shop. It was conveniently located just 8 minutes away from our AirBnB. I really appreciated that they had non-herbal drinks like chamomile, and their cream was really good, too. The food didn’t look filling but it basically ended up being our lunch. I was so glad to finally be able to have afternoon tea in Europe, and it was also a nice chill time for the 3 of us to just hang out and chat:

In the evening, we also wanted to try to find somewhere to eat that had live music. We had a first choice but it was a bit crowded for our taste, and then finally found somewhere that was a bit more chill that had a band but also dancers:
